ATTRIBUTED TO KEISAI EISEN (1790–1848) OR KIKUKAWA EIZAN (1787-1867) Edo period (1615-1868), first half of the 19th century An oban yoko-e shunga print titled Asakusa ichi ni yoru[...] oiran (High-ranking Courtesan Visiting [her lover] during an Outing to the Asakusa Fair) depicting an oiran making love to her lover after visiting the Tori no ichi (Rooster Fair), unsigned; in a card mount. 25.7cm x 37cm (10 1/8in x 14 9/16in).
